Ngữ pháp

Present tense issue

× I never had an opportunity to own a bike, uh, because the weather in the city that I live in was really hot and instead I used to, I used to play indoor games with my siblings.

I never had an opportunity to own a bike because the weather in the city where I lived was really hot, and instead I used to play indoor games with my siblings.

Mixed tense and relative clause choice: 'the city that I live in was' mixes present 'live' with past 'was'. The context is past (childhood), so use past 'lived'. Use 'where I lived' for a smoother relative clause. Remove the repeated 'I used to' redundancy. Overall, keep verbs consistent in past tense for clarity.

Incorrect use of adjectives or adverbs

× Therefore, we use cards because it's more sufficient.

Therefore, we use cars because they are more practical.

Word choice error: 'cards' is likely a mistaken word for 'cars'. 'More sufficient' is incorrect English; use 'more practical', 'more efficient', or 'more suitable'. Also match pronoun and verb number: 'they are' for plural 'cars'.
